SI5342B-B-GM Overview
The mounting type for this particular component is surface mount, making it easy to install on a variety of surfaces. The package or case is a 44-VFQFN exposed pad, providing extra stability and protection for the internal components. The packaging for this component is a tray, ensuring safe transportation and storage. It also has an additional feature of requiring a 3.3V supply. The terminal form is no lead, making it environmentally friendly. The peak reflow temperature is 260 degrees Celsius, ensuring the component can withstand high temperatures. The output options for this component include CML, HCSL, LVCMOS, LVDS, and LVPECL, providing versatility for different applications. It is classified under the JESD-30 code S-XQCC-N44 and has a single circuit. Finally, it has a differential input and output, making it suitable for high-speed data transmission.

SI5342B-B-GM More Descriptions
PLL Clock Multiplier/Attenuator Single 0.001MHz to 350MHz 44-Pin QFN Bulk
Low-jitter, 2-output, any frequency (< 350 MHz), any output jitter attenuator
Clock Generator 0.008MHz to 750MHz-IN 350MHz-OUT 44-Pin QFN EP Tray
Base/blank prototyping device: Single PLL Jitter Attenuator: 2-outputs up to 350 MHz; Integer Fractional synthesis
